一步到位解决API版本过旧引发的转账问题:OPENAPI_VERSION_TOO_OLD错误排查与升级指南 (一步到位指的是)

VERSION

作为一名无法公布身份的中文编辑,我无法直接透露我的具体工作背景,但基于对技术文档和网络生态的长期观察,我得以从独特视角剖析“一步到位解决API版本过旧引发的转账问题:OPENAPI_VERSION_TOO_OLD错误排查与升级指南”这一命题。以下分析将深入其技术逻辑、用户痛点、文档结构及潜在策略,旨在揭示“一步到位”这一承诺背后的真实含义与实现路径。

从技术架构角度看,“OPENAPI_VERSION_TOO_OLD”错误是API版本管理中的典型问题,尤其在金融转账场景中尤为敏感。API作为系统间通信的桥梁,其版本迭代往往伴随着功能增强、安全修复或协议变更。当旧版本API因底层依赖、加密标准或数据格式的升级而过时,转账请求可能因不兼容被拒绝。这里的“一步到位”并非指一次点击即可修复,而是指通过系统化的排查与升级流程,将用户从碎片化的错误信息中解放出来,直接导向最优解决方案。实际上,这种错误往往源于客户端固守的陈旧代码,而服务端已强制推进新版本。因此,文档的深层价值在于构建一条清晰的因果链:错误日志→版本比对→代码更新→环境测试→安全验证。每一步都需精准衔接,以减少用户的试错成本。

从用户心理层面分析,转账涉及资金安全与时效性,用户对“一步到位”的期待远超普通错误处理。他们需要的是确定性,而非泛泛而谈的“建议升级”。优秀的技术文档应避免假定用户具备全栈知识,而是提供渐进式引导。例如,排查阶段应包含:如何通过HTTP响应头或错误代码定位具体旧版本号;升级指南需列举常见语言(如Python、Java、JavaScript)下的SDK更新命令,并强调向后兼容性测试。更重要的是,文档必须警示“一步到位”的潜在陷阱:若忽略参数变更或权限模型,升级后可能引发新错误。因此,真正的“一步到位”是平衡速度与精确度的产物,它要求内容编辑具备预判用户跳跃思考的能力,将碎片信息整合为闭环。

进一步而言,文档的标题本身是一种承诺,但需谨慎定义“一步”的尺度。在实操中,“一步”可能对应多个维度:是环境诊断的标准化,即通过自动化工具(如Postman或cURL脚本)快速复现错误,替代手动解析。是升级路径的模板化,例如提供预配置的YAML文件或Docker镜像,使开发者只需替换旧SDK依赖。是回滚机制的一键化,以防升级后出现连锁故障。现实中多数用户卡在“排查”环节,因为他们缺乏对API版本生命周期(EOL)的可见性。为此,文档应内置版本对照表,标记每个旧版本的退役日期、强制升级窗口及典型错误码。这实际上是在重塑用户认知:与其说“一步到位”,不如说是用结构化信息消除模糊性,让用户觉得每一步都坚实可靠。

从编辑视角出发,我观察到这类文档常见通病包括理论堆砌、步骤遗漏或语言晦涩。例如,有些指南直接抛出“将OpenAPI版本升级至2.0或更高”,却未说明如何验证当前版本。更隐晦的问题是,转账API常涉及敏感数据(如账户ID、金额),升级时必须确保加密算法(如从TLS 1.2升级至1.3)或签名机制未被破坏。若文档仅聚焦技术参数,而忽略业务逻辑验证,用户升级后可能误将“成功”视为终点,实则资金路径已偏离。因此,我的角色要求我在不暴露身份的前提下,化身为“隐形质检员”,通过推演用户操作路径来优化内容。例如,我常会要求补充“升级后执行最小权限转账测试”步骤,并嵌入错误日志示例,让用户能独立比对。

在技术生态演进中,API版本的过时往往是渐变而非突变的。许多用户直到错误阻断业务时才意识到问题。这时,“一步到位”指南的价值在于提供从诊断到验证的全链路解决方案,而非停留在表面。我特别关注文档是否包含“剪枝”策略:当旧版本SDK包含多个废弃接口时,是否指导用户只更新必要部分,而非强制全面重构。例如,开放银行API标准(如Open Banking)常要求版本升级后交易ID格式变化,若文档仅说明“更新版本号”,用户可能忽略字段映射调整,导致转账失败但状态却显示“成功”。这提醒我们,“一步到位”的实质是减少信息差,让用户无需成为专家就能安全过渡。

从责任边界看,编辑需平衡技术准确性与可读性。由于我不能公布身份,我假设自己在幕后进行“语义降维”:将专业术语转化为场景化描述,并用“为什么”解释每个步骤背后的逻辑。比如,解释“为什么旧版本导致转账失败”时,可类比“旧钥匙开新锁”;强调测试重要性时,用“换轮子后试跑一段路”等方式。这种表达既保留内核,又降低门槛。我偏好采用对比表格,列出新旧版本在认证、限流、错误码等维度的差异,并用红色标注关键变更点。

“一步到位解决API版本过旧引发的转账问题”不仅是一个技术文档主题,更是对信息组织能力的终极考验。它要求编辑去伪存真,将复杂升级拆解为可执行步骤,同时预判用户可能偏离的隐形路标。作为幕后编辑,我虽无法标明身份,但通过逐字推敲、逻辑连贯及风险警示,我能将“一步到位”从营销口号转化为用户手中真正的“万能钥匙”。这份分析说明意在揭示:真正的“一步到位”,是让用户在阅读后既感到“每一步都明清晰”,又不必担忧“下一步是陷阱”。它是对技术利他主义的一次践行,也是编辑价值的无声绽放。


求解严重:Exceptionstartingfilterstruts2

OLD错误排查与升级指南

很明显的错误:FilterDispatcher找不到FilterDispatcher这个类(FilterDispatcher分发器,是Struts2框架的核心Dispatcher,没有它,也就谈不起Struts2框架)首先:看看有没有导入Struts2相应的jar包,是否齐全。最少要导入五个基本包如果该包含的jar包都引入了,再看,配置文件是否配置正确,struts2使用的是Filter充当Control需要配置如下:注意类名和包名不要写错<filter><filter-name>struts2</filter-name><filter-class></filter-class></filter><filter-mapping><filter-name>struts2</filter-name><url-pattern>*</url-pattern></filter-mapping><filter-mapping><filter-name>struts2</filter-name><url-pattern>/struts/*</url-pattern></filter-mapping>如果以上两步都没有问题,那估计就是环境问题了,在开发中,环境问题是麻烦的事,检查你用的部署服务器(Tomcat或weblogic等)、IDE的版本(eclipse或者myEclipse),以及Struts2的版本2项目中配置2.1与2.0的区别具体的过滤器类变了,2.0配置是以上写法2.1以后是这样配置<filter><filter-name>struts2</filter-name><filter-class></filter-class></filter><filter-mapping><filter-name>struts2</filter-name><url-pattern>/*</url-pattern></filter-mapping>另外,也与你导入jar包的位置有关,建议最好放入工程WEB-INF下的lib目录里,有时不能识别

Node.js 适合用来做 web 开发吗

异步的思维是js的特点,也是node高并发性能优势的原因之一,你从传统的同步语言过来可能不习惯,但是像我们这种从前端写js过来的人就自然得像说话一样,关键还是适应。

熟悉之后可以用async,Promise系 (q, bluebird) 或者 eventproxy 之类的库来改善代码嵌套的问题。

异常的问题 – Node 核心库的 API 抛异常大致有三种常见情况:1. 异步回调。

按惯例,接收的回调函数第一个参数都是可能出现的异常,没有特殊情况的话你应该把异常按照同样的参数位置一层层传下去,直到最顶层的回调里进行统一处理。

2. 同步版本的api会直接抛异常。

所以如果确实无法避免抛错的可能,直接 try catch,要么就避免用同步版本。

3. Stream形态的API,必须在stream对象上添加 error 的侦听函数,不然异常会直接抛出。

如果出现导致进程中断的异常,说明你的代码有逻辑层面的问题(以上几点没有完全做好),你应该在开发的时候发现并处理这些异常,而不是让它们在部署环境中发生。

如果你实在避免不了问题发生,你可以用 Node 的 Domain API 来对整块代码的异常进行捕捉。

另外可以用进程管理工具比如 forever, pm2 或是 monit 监视应用进程,崩溃后自动重启。

最后回到你的问题,node是否适合做web开发 – node的独特优势是高并发,高实时性,或者单页富前端的web应用,比如实时聊天,游戏,另外node也是写JSON API的最好选择。

什么是firework窗口抖动色

firework窗口抖动色是指该程序16进制的色彩模式Fireworks 是 Macromedia 三套网页利器之一,它是用来画图用的,它相当于结合了 Photoshop( 点阵图处理 )以及CorelDraw(绘制向量图 ) 的功能。

网页上很流行的阴影、立体按钮…等等的效果,也只需用鼠标点一Fireworks 是 Macromedia 三套网页利器之一,它是用来画图用的,它相当于结合了 Photoshop( 点阵图处理 )以及CorelDraw(绘制向量图 ) 的功能。

网页上很流行的阴影、立体按钮…等等的效果,也只需用鼠标点一下,不必再靠什么KPT之类的外挂滤镜。

而且 Fireworks很完整的支持网页 16 进制的色彩模式,提供安全色盘的使用和转换,要切割图形、做影像对应( Image Map )、背景透明,要图又小又漂亮,在Fireworks 中做起来都非常方便,修改图形也是很容易的 。

不需要再同时打开Photoshop 和 CorelDraw…等等各类软体,切换来切换去的了。

Fireworks MX新功能有:1、 执行效率的提高2、 用户界面的改进3、 内建FTP登陆和版本控制4、 新的特效5、 自动图形6、 新的照片修饰工具7、 服务器端代码的支持8、 系统反锯齿和自定义反锯齿9、 双字节支持10、提供了JavaScript API接口

© 版权声明
THE END
喜欢就支持一下吧
点赞12 分享
评论 抢沙发

请登录后发表评论

    暂无评论内容